# VOICEVOX Narration System
Complete workflow for converting Miyabi development progress into Yukkuri-style voice narration using VOICEVOX Engine API.
## When to Use
- User requests "create voice narration", "generate audio guide", "create development report"
- After significant development milestones (weekly/daily reports)
- When preparing YouTube content for development updates
- For team communication in audio format
## Workflow Steps
### 1. VOICEVOX Engine Status Check
```bash
# Check if VOICEVOX Engine is running
curl -s http://127.0.0.1:50021/version
# If not running, start it (optional with -s flag)
cd /Users/a003/dev/voicevox_engine
uv run run.py --enable_mock --host 127.0.0.1 --port 50021
```
### 2. Generate Script from Git Commits
```bash
cd /Users/a003/dev/miyabi-private/tools
# Basic execution (last 3 days)
python3 yukkuri-narration-generator.py
# Custom time range
python3 yukkuri-narration-generator.py --days 7
# Outputs:
# - script.md: Yukkuri-style dialogue script (Reimu & Marisa)
# - voicevox_requests.json: API request data
```
### 3. Synthesize Audio with VOICEVOX
```bash
# Generate WAV files from script
python3 voicevox-synthesizer.py
# Outputs:
# - audio/speaker0_000.wav (Reimu)
# - audio/speaker1_001.wav (Marisa)
# - ... (multiple audio files)
```
### 4. Unified Execution (Recommended)
```bash
# All-in-one script with options
./miyabi-narrate.sh
# With custom options
./miyabi-narrate.sh --days 7 --output ~/Desktop/narration --start-engine
# Options:
# -d, --days N Past N days of commits (default: 3)
# -o, --output DIR Output directory (default: ./output)
# -s, --start-engine Auto-start VOICEVOX Engine
# -k, --keep-engine Keep Engine running after completion
```
### 5. Verify Output
```bash
# Check generated files
ls -lh output/
# Play audio (macOS)
afplay output/audio/speaker0_000.wav
# Read script
cat output/script.md
```
## Project-Specific Considerations
### Git Commits Parsing
The system parses Conventional Commits format:
- **Type**: feat, fix, docs, security, test, refactor
- **Scope**: Module name (e.g., design, web-ui)
- **Issue Number**: Extracted from #XXX format
- **Phase**: Extracted from "Phase X.X" format
Example commit message:
```
feat(design): complete Phase 0.4 - Issue #425
```
### VOICEVOX Speaker IDs
Default configuration:
- **Speaker ID 0**: Reimu (霊夢) - Explanation role
- **Speaker ID 1**: Marisa (魔理沙) - Reaction role
To customize speakers:
1. Check available speakers:
```bash
curl http://127.0.0.1:50021/speakers | python -m json.tool
```
2. Edit `tools/yukkuri-narration-generator.py`:
```python
self.reimu_speaker_id = 3 # Change to desired speaker
self.marisa_speaker_id = 6 # Change to desired speaker
```
### Output Structure
```
output/
├── script.md # Yukkuri-style dialogue script
├── voicevox_requests.json # VOICEVOX API request data
├── SUMMARY.md # Execution summary report
└── audio/ # Audio files (WAV format)
├── speaker0_000.wav # Reimu (intro)
├── speaker1_001.wav # Marisa (response)
├── speaker0_002.wav # Reimu (commit 1)
└── ...
```
## Common Issues
### Issue: VOICEVOX Engine Connection Failed
**Symptoms**:
```
❌ VOICEVOX Engineに接続できません
```
**Solutions**:
1. Check if Engine is running:
```bash
curl http://127.0.0.1:50021/version
```
2. Start Engine manually:
```bash
cd /Users/a003/dev/voicevox_engine
uv run run.py --enable_mock
```
3. Or use auto-start option:
```bash
./miyabi-narrate.sh --start-engine
```
### Issue: No Audio Files Generated
**Symptoms**:
- `audio/` directory is empty
- VOICEVOX API errors
**Solutions**:
1. Verify `voicevox_requests.json` exists:
```bash
cat voicevox_requests.json
```
2. Check speaker IDs are valid:
```bash
curl http://127.0.0.1:50021/speakers
```
3. Re-run synthesis:
```bash
python3 voicevox-synthesizer.py
```
### Issue: No Git Commits Found
**Symptoms**:
```
0件のコミットを取得しました
```
**Solutions**:
1. Verify you're in a Git repository:
```bash
git log --oneline --since="3 days ago"
```
2. Check if commits exist in the time range:
```bash
git log --oneline --since="7 days ago"
```
3. Run from correct directory:
```bash
cd /Users/a003/dev/miyabi-private
tools/yukkuri-narration-generator.py
```
